 THE real terror is Maverni. Good recruit-everywhere sacreds with +4 str from 0-research national holy spell, Gifts from Heaven spam, Ring of Wizardry from national mages, Master Enslave without communion... Add some Air, a little bit of Death, maybe a bit of blood for sacrifice and boots- and watch the slaughter.

		10% shot at an s4 druid, which with skullcap/ros/crystal coin/crystal shield/northern star/gems might actually allow you to get under 200 fatigue   
they also have a really small (0.25% I think?) shot at an s5 druid, and there's always the dimensional rod. ofc using all those boosters means your penetration will suck, so I think I'd rather just commune for master enslave, personally.
